Gold prices drop by Tk1,750 per bhori

The Bangladesh Jeweller's Association (Bajus) on Sunday (August 17) announced a reduction in gold prices by Tk1,750 per bhori. 

According to a Bajus press release, the price cut comes as a result of a decline in the local market value of pure gold. 

The Bajus took the decision today to adjust the prices with the international market, said the press release.

From tomorrow, the price of each bhori will be Tk 99,027, down from Tk 1, 00,777 earlier.

On July 20 this year, each bhori of gold price in Bangladesh cross the Tk 100,000-mark for the first time.

Jewellers hiked gold prices by Tk 2,333 per bhori on July 20 which set a new record, with each bhori priced at Tk 1, 00,777 in Bangladesh.

Earlier on March 18, the gold price in the local market was jumped by Tk 7,698 to record Tk 98,794 per bhori.
